Google Cloud is already available in over 150 countries, and the U.K. is the latest addition to that list, with the company announcing the signing of a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with U.K. Crown Commercial Service. CCS is the nation's Liverpool-based executive agency responsible for managing the procurement of 'common goods' and services.
The office is in charge of increasing savings for U.K. taxpayers by centralizing purchasing requirements, and in a statement, a Google Cloud spokesperson told me, the agreement should make it easier and more affordable for those working in the U.K. public sector to innovate using Google Cloud services:
"U.K. public sector agencies can now leverage the full range of Google Cloud’s services to increase innovation and deliver digital transformation"
CSS said in a statement, its office first inquired about Google Cloud back in 2019, wanting to ensure it met the requirements for cloud services under the U.K.'s 'One Government Cloud Strategy.' The joint initiative between Cabinet Office and Government Digital Service will make cloud services more accessible to more suppliers.

In line with accessibility, Google Cloud and CSS are offering there's a discount for those who qualify as public sector bodies based on demand and anticipated spending. This move could boost much of the U.K.'s government offices, councils, NHS-bodies, public funded-broadcasters, and charities into the digital age if the duo can convey the benefits of cloud deployment.
It will undoubtedly take the hard work of Google Cloud and CCS, which both said they'll focus on providing support for U.K.-based SMEs that partner with public sector agencies, adding: "No matter where they are in their cloud adoption journeys."
